The DevOps Foundation (DOFD) certification is an entry-level credential from the DevOps Institute that validates a foundational understanding of DevOps culture, practices and principles in an IT environment. It is the recognised starting point for professionals who want to speak the language of continuous delivery and collaboration. The course is grounded in the current DevOps Foundation Body of Knowledge (BoK), the exam blueprint published by the DevOps Institute, now part of PeopleCert. You explore the Three Ways of DevOps, the CALMS framework, CI/CD pipelines, DORA metrics, and how Agile, ITSM and Lean IT connect, then sit a 40-question, 60-minute closed-book exam that has no formal prerequisites.
